Commit 3d37cc2

mo khan <mo@mokhan.ca>
2010-07-11 00:04:55
updated create.configs target
1 parent e700d5a
build/config/log4net.config.xml.template
@@ -1,26 +1,27 @@
-<log4net>
-	<appender name='RollingFileAppender' type='log4net.Appender.RollingFileAppender'>
-		<file value='logs\log.txt' />
-		<appendToFile value='true' />
-		<rollingStyle value='Size' />
-		<maxSizeRollBackups value='10' />
-		<maximumFileSize value='100000KB' />
-		<staticLogFileName value='true' />
-		<layout type='log4net.Layout.PatternLayout'>
-			<conversionPattern value="%d %-5p %c - [%t] %m%n" />
-		</layout>
-	</appender>
-	<appender name="Console" type="log4net.Appender.ConsoleAppender">
-		<layout type="log4net.Layout.PatternLayout">
-			<conversionPattern value="%d %-5p %c - [%t] %m%n" />
-		</layout>
-	</appender>
-	<root>
-		<level value='@log.level@' />
-		<appender-ref ref='RollingFileAppender' />			
-	</root>
-	<logger name="NHibernate" additivity="false">
-		<level value="ERROR" />
-		<appender-ref ref="RollingFileAppender" />
-	</logger>
+<log4net>
+	<appender name='RollingFileAppender' type='log4net.Appender.RollingFileAppender'>
+		<file value='logs\log.txt' />
+		<appendToFile value='true' />
+		<rollingStyle value='Size' />
+		<maxSizeRollBackups value='10' />
+		<maximumFileSize value='100000KB' />
+		<staticLogFileName value='true' />
+		<layout type='log4net.Layout.PatternLayout'>
+			<conversionPattern value="%d %-5p %c - [%t] %m%n" />
+		</layout>
+	</appender>
+	<appender name="Console" type="log4net.Appender.ConsoleAppender">
+		<layout type="log4net.Layout.PatternLayout">
+			<conversionPattern value="%d %-5p %c - [%t] %m%n" />
+		</layout>
+	</appender>
+	<root>
+		<level value='@log.level@' />
+		<appender-ref ref='RollingFileAppender' />			
+		<appender-ref ref='Console' />			
+	</root>
+	<logger name="NHibernate" additivity="false">
+		<level value="ERROR" />
+		<appender-ref ref="RollingFileAppender" />
+	</logger>
 </log4net>
\ No newline at end of file
build/project.build
@@ -28,9 +28,10 @@
 	</target>
 	
 	<target name="app.compile" depends="init">
-    <exec program="C:\WINDOWS\Microsoft.NET\Framework\v3.5\MSBuild.exe"
+	  <property name="msbuild.exe" value="${framework::get-framework-directory(framework::get-target-framework())}\msbuild.exe" />
+	  <exec program="${msbuild.exe}"
           workingdir="${base.dir}"
-          commandline="solution.sln /p:Configuration=Release;OutDir=${build.compile.dir}\ /t:Rebuild /nologo /m /v:q"
+          commandline="studio.sln /p:Configuration=Release;OutDir=${build.compile.dir}\ /t:Rebuild /nologo /m /v:q"
           />
 	</target>
 
build/project.deploy.build
@@ -6,14 +6,13 @@
   <target name="create.configs">
 		<property name="target" value="${log4net.config}" />
 		<call target="expand.template.file" />
-		<copy file="${build.config.dir}\log4net.config.xml" tofile="${product.dir}\client\boot\log4net.config.xml" />
-		<copy file="${build.config.dir}\log4net.config.xml" tofile="${product.dir}\client\presentation.windows\log4net.config.xml" />
-		<copy file="${build.config.dir}\log4net.config.xml" tofile="${product.dir}\presentation.windows.server\log4net.config.xml" />
+		<copy file="${build.config.dir}\log4net.config.xml" tofile="${product.dir}\client\client.ui\log4net.config.xml" />
+		<copy file="${build.config.dir}\log4net.config.xml" tofile="${product.dir}\client\server\log4net.config.xml" />
     
 		<property name="target" value="${assembly.config}" />
 		<call target="expand.template.file" />
-		<copy file="${build.config.dir}\AssemblyInfo.cs" tofile="${product.dir}\client\boot\Properties\AssemblyInfo.cs" />
-		<copy file="${build.config.dir}\AssemblyInfo.cs" tofile="${product.dir}\client\presentation.windows\Properties\AssemblyInfo.cs" />
+		<copy file="${build.config.dir}\AssemblyInfo.cs" tofile="${product.dir}\client\client.ui\Properties\AssemblyInfo.cs" />
+		<copy file="${build.config.dir}\AssemblyInfo.cs" tofile="${product.dir}\client\server\Properties\AssemblyInfo.cs" />
   </target>
 
 	<target name="deploy" depends="create.configs, app.compile" />
product/support/unit/unit.csproj
@@ -48,7 +48,6 @@
   </ItemGroup>
   <ItemGroup>
     <Compile Include="client\presenters\AddFamilyMemberPresenterSpecs.cs" />
-    <Compile Include="Properties\AssemblyInfo.cs" />
   </ItemGroup>
   <ItemGroup>
     <ProjectReference Include="..\..\client\client.ui\client.csproj">
@@ -56,6 +55,9 @@
       <Name>client %28client\client%29</Name>
     </ProjectReference>
   </ItemGroup>
+  <ItemGroup>
+    <Folder Include="Properties\" />
+  </ItemGroup>
   <Import Project="$(MSBuildToolsPath)\Microsoft.CSharp.targets" />
   <!-- To modify your build process, add your task inside one of the targets below and uncomment it. 
        Other similar extension points exist, see Microsoft.Common.targets.
studio.sln
@@ -79,5 +79,6 @@ Global
 		{6BDCB0C1-51E1-435A-93D8-CA02BF8E409C} = {099D479D-7BFC-428E-A897-9189C294C9C8}
 		{DD8FD29E-7424-415C-9BA3-7D9F6ECBA161} = {099D479D-7BFC-428E-A897-9189C294C9C8}
 		{04B70A19-AE24-490A-A1F3-868C56E21E29} = {842107F2-46AF-4FF8-BF8B-0907B3C4B6D6}
+		{B8505B10-85C7-45F4-B039-D364DD556D7D} = {842107F2-46AF-4FF8-BF8B-0907B3C4B6D6}
 	EndGlobalSection
 EndGlobal